Endurance Check in for Fall 2020 ~Run Bike Swim Hike
 
New month, new goals, newcomers welcome!

INTRO: This check-in celebrates the art of staying in motion. Some of us are training for marathons, some for 5Ks and others for triathlons. Some of us are just training for life or trying to keep up with life.

We talk a lot about running, but we are also cyclists, occasional swimmers, hikers, past and future triathletes and any other long distance sport you can think of. We struggle with fitting in all the workouts, what we "should" be doing to overcoming injuries and life's challenges. We learn from one another and trade training tips, links to cute workout clothes and, of course, recommendations for good workouts.

This thread will be for September, October and November.

Fall questions:
1. Has your endurance training changed without races to train for?
2. What is your go-to activity for stress management?
3. If you could learn something new, fitness or otherwise, what would it be?
